Precautions
Safety
1. Avoid Radio Frequency Interference
Do not place the reader near a television or radio receiver.
2. Avoid Stacking
Do not place heavy objects on the reader.
3. Keep Small Objects Away
Do not insert paper clips or other small objects into reader.
There is the risk of heat, fire or explosion.
4. Keep Dry
There is the risk of heat, fire or explosion.
5. Do Not Disassemble the Reader
Do not attempt to disassemble the reader. There is the risk of explosion.
Maintenance
Clean the device with a dry soft cloth
Stubborn stains may be removed with a cloth slightly dampened with a
solution of mild soap and finish with a dry cloth.
Notice:
Never use solvents such as alcohol, benzene or thinner for cleaning. Also do
not apply insecticide, glass cleaner or hair spray for cleaning. (this may cause
color fading or feel changing.)
Specifications
Items Description Specifications
Type Monochrome LCD Display
Resolution 64×128 pixels
Dimensions Approx.W90 mm×H47 mm×D150 mm
Weight Approx.255 g(not include cables)
Power
requirements
24 V DC Max.150 mA
Operating
Temperature
0 to 40 Environment
Operating
Humidity
30 % to 80 %RH (no condensation)
Radio Freq. 13.56 MHz IC Card
Communication Card Type FeliCa ©
Communication Wired Serial communication

Federal Communications Commission Requirements
Note:
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class A
dig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to
provide reasonable protection against harmful interference when the equipment is
operated in a commercial environment. This equipment generates, uses, and can
rad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with
the instruction manual, may cause harmful interference to radio communications.
Operation of this equipment in a residential area is likely to cause harmful interference
in which case the user will be required to correct the interference at his own expense.
This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the
following two conditions: (1) This device may not cause harmful interference, and (2)
this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may
cause undesired operation.
FCC WARNING
Changes or modifications not expressly approved by the party responsible for
compliance could void the user’s authority to operate the equipment.
